Located in the beautiful village of Manton, in the heart of Rutland overlooking Rutland Water, the home is a purpose-built care home extended onto a grand country residence, providing 24-hour residential care in a comfortable and secure setting for the frail-elderly person and those with mild to advanced dementia.

There is an abundance of space, both inside and out. The home provides a warm and secure environment, with spacious, furnished en-suite bedroom facilities. Together with a large lounge, dining area and conservatory, there are varied areas that residents are welcome to access and use as their own.

The welcoming atmosphere at Manton stems not just from the comfortable and stylish interiors, but also from the wide range of engaging daily activities on offer, led by the amazing activities team. These include daily exercise classes & chair aerobics, local community visits, gardening, music therapy, arts & crafts, hair & spa treatments, shopping trips & excursions.

The home is registered with Rutland County Council and CQC and holds a Good rating by CQC in all areas of inspection, Safe, Effective, Caring, Responsive and Well Led (January 2020).

My brother-in-law is a stroke victim and has been resident for 2 years. It has been a very difficult time for the care home and staff as they tried to provide the best possible service in the face of staff shortages and the Covid pandemic. Manton's record of keeping Covid out of Manton Hall for so long
should be a major source of pride for all. My brother-in-law's condition means that he is not an easy individual to deal with but throughout I have been grateful for the efforts of the Manton Hall staff to care for him. My only concern has arisen recently and relates to management's response in regard to medically appropriate transport for hospital visits. National constraints on ambulance availability have prevented my brother-in-law from attending several medical appointments. The lack of availability of NHS transport is beyond the control of Manton Hall, however the circumstances were foreseeable and alternative arrangements could have been proactively put in place.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  • a) 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months.

    The Average Rating of 4.979 for Manton Hall is calculated as follows: ( (139 Excellents x 5) + (3 Goods x 4) ) ÷ 142 Ratings = 4.979

  • b) 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5').

    The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Manton Hall is based on 12 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    • i) 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4

    • ii) 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 34 registered maximum number of service users is 6.8, which has been reached with 12 Positive reviews. Points = 1
